06/02/2005 20:54 chocoman4k#12
You mean before picking up?
When you pick an item up, you will notice a delay. That's the time that you need to send a packet to the server (telling it: I'm picking up item at position x,y), and the time it needs to come back (giving you the extended information about the item), otherwise the delay equal to your ping would be useless if you would know all informations about it even before picking up.
